The Incomparable 220: ‘Authentic Cop Mustache’

This week on my pop-culture podcast The Incomparable, we wade into the world of webcomics, discussing the explosion of sequential art on the Internet and our very favorite webcomics. If you don’t spend hours and hours reading comics after listening to this episode, we haven’t done our jobs. There’s also some bonus material.
